Lauretta Onnochie, former media aide to ex-President
Muhammadu Buhari, has spoken to President Bola Tinubu on the repercussions from
the Niger Delta in 2027 due to his actions in Rivers State.
Onnochie warned that the Niger Delta people will punish
Tinubu for the alleged lawlessness he imposed on Rivers State.
She accused Tinubu of imposing an illegal and
unconstitutional emergency rule in Rivers State for six months.
On March 18, 2025, Tinubu declared a state of emergency in
Rivers State, suspending Governor Sim Fubara, the deputy governor, and all
members of the state House of Assembly.
During the suspension, Tinubu appointed Ibok Ibas as Sole
Administrator to manage the state, aiming to prevent a political crisis.
Onoche wrote: “Tinubu never thought that the 6 months of
hell he illegally and unconstitutionally imposed on Rivers State will come to
an end.
”That lawlessness will be punished in 2027 by Niger Delltans.
We are set.”
